Основы HTML и CSS для начинающих

Разработка веб-ресурсов стартует с освоения двух базовых инструментов. HTML отвечает за архитектуру и содержимое веб-страниц. CSS регулирует визуальным стилизацией элементов.

Программисты задействуют HTML для размещения текста, графики, ссылок и других элементов. CSS позволяет задавать тона, гарнитуры, размеры и позиционирование элементов. Эти языки работают вместе и дополняются друг друга.

Постижение вулкан казино официальный сайт даёт дорогу к профессии веб-разработчика. Владение фундаментальных правил способствует разрабатывать работающие и красивые порталы. Начинающие специалисты могут стремительно получить практические компетенции и применить их в живых работах.

Что такое HTML и зачем он необходим сайту

HTML интерпретируется как HyperText Markup Language. Язык разметки устанавливает структуру веб-документов и упорядочивает наполнение веб-страниц. Браузеры интерпретируют HTML-код и отображают информацию в доступном для посетителей формате.

Каждый блок страницы описывается особыми директивами. Заголовки, абзацы, перечни, таблицы и формы создаются с посредством тегов. Теги представляют собой команды, размещённые в угловые скобки. Браузер обрабатывает эти команды и строит графическое отображение содержимого.

Без HTML невозможно построить Вулкан казино любого рода. Язык разметки является базой для всех интернет-ресурсов. Поисковые системы изучают HTML-структуру для индексации страниц. Грамотная структура улучшает ранги сайта в итогах поиска.

HTML регулярно совершенствуется и получает свежие возможности. Новейшая версия HTML5 поддерживает видео, аудио и интерактивные компоненты. Программисты могут внедрять медийный материал без внешних модулей. Семантические метки способствуют Вулкан лучше понимать назначение разных блоков веб-страницы.

Главные элементы и архитектура веб-страницы

Любой HTML-документ содержит чёткую многоуровневую архитектуру. Основной компонент html содержит всё контент страницы. Внутри размещаются два ключевых блока: head и body.

Секция head хранит служебную данные о документе. Здесь задаётся заголовок страницы, подключаются стили и скрипты. Посетители не видят содержимое этого раздела прямо. Секция body включает весь доступный материал.

Для структурирования материала задействуются разнообразные теги:

Семантические элементы делают структуру более понятной. Элемент header определяет верхнюю часть сайта. Элемент nav группирует навигационные линки. Блок main содержит главное контент страницы. Footer размещается в подвальной зоне и вмещает контактную данные.

Грамотная архитектура файла важна для доступности. Программы чтения с экрана применяют казино Вулкан для навигации по странице. Структурированная организация элементов облегчает понимание сведений всеми типами посетителей. Правильный программа действует корректно во всех новых браузерах.

Как CSS отвечает за визуальный облик сайта

CSS декодируется как Cascading Style Sheets. Каскадные таблицы стилей определяют визуальное отображение HTML-элементов. Механизм разделяет стилизацию от организации файла.

Без стилей все сайты смотрятся монотонно. Браузер выводит текст чёрным оттенком на белом подложке. Заголовки получают базовые размеры. CSS позволяет изменить любой аспект внешнего оформления.

Стили можно подключить тремя способами. Внешний документ соединяется с HTML-документом посредством тег link. Внутренние стили размещаются в элементе style. Инлайновые стили прописываются в параметре компонента.

Каскадность обозначает иерархию применения директив. Инлайновые стили обладают наивысший вес. Внутренние стили замещают внешние. Браузер использует наиболее специфичное директиву к каждому компоненту.

CSS регулирует всеми зрительными характеристиками. Специалисты задают оттенки фона и текста. Стили изменяют размеры, поля и обводки контейнеров. Современный Вулкан казино применяет анимации и переходы для генерации динамических визуальных эффектов.

Селекторы, параметры и параметры в CSS

Правило CSS формируется из трёх частей. Селектор обозначает тег для оформления. Свойство определяет характеристику дизайна. Значение устанавливает точный параметр.

Селекторы определяют элементы по разнообразным параметрам. Селектор метки назначает стили ко всем элементам конкретного типа. Селектор класса работает с атрибутом class. Селектор идентификатора определяет уникальный компонент по параметру id.

Составные селекторы генерируют более специфичные инструкции. Селектор потомка определяет внутренние элементы. Селектор дочернего тега действует только с прямыми детьми. Псевдоклассы назначают стили при заданных условиях.

Параметры описывают разнообразные аспекты стилизации. Свойства color и background-color регулируют цветовой схемой. Атрибуты width и height устанавливают габариты. Свойства margin и padding управляют отступы.

Величины записываются в разнообразных форматах. Оттенки указываются в шестнадцатеричном виде, RGB или наименованиями. Величины определяются в пикселях, процентах или относительных величинах. Грамотное использование селекторов способствует Вулкан продуктивно регулировать стилизацией совокупности тегов.

Взаимодействие с цветами, шрифтами и отступами

Цветовое стилизация создаёт графическую настроение страницы. Атрибут color изменяет тон содержимого. Свойство background-color устанавливает задний план элемента. Тона записываются несколькими способами: именами, шестнадцатеричными записями или параметрами RGB.

Шестнадцатеричный вид стартует с символа решётки. Код формируется из шести символов, представляющих красный, зелёный и синий составляющие. Вид RGB задействует цифровые величины от 0 до 255 для каждого компонента. Формат RGBA вносит характеристику непрозрачности.

Оформление текста влияет на читаемость содержимого. Параметр font-family задаёт семейство шрифта. Параметр font-size определяет величину надписи. Параметр font-weight регулирует жирность начертания. Атрибут line-height определяет межстрочный промежуток.

Системные гарнитуры доступны на всех аппаратах. Онлайн-шрифты подгружаются с сторонних хостов. Сервис Google Fonts обеспечивает безвозмездную библиотеку шрифтов. Программисты задают несколько гарнитур в последовательности важности.

Отступы генерируют место около блоков. Атрибут margin создаёт внешние интервалы между контейнерами. Свойство padding создаёт внутренние поля от рамок до наполнения. Отступы можно задавать для каждой стороны раздельно или единым значением одновременно для всех краёв. Правильное применение казино Вулкан улучшает зрительную иерархию и усвоение информации.

Блочная модель и размещение блоков

Блочная концепция характеризует организацию каждого HTML-элемента. Схема состоит из четырёх зон: контента, внутреннего интервала, обводки и внешнего поля. Осознание этой принципа требуется для точного контроля величинами.

Область содержимого содержит текст и иллюстрации. Внутренний поле padding формирует пространство между контентом и границей. Граница border обрамляет элемент отображаемой полосой. Внешний отступ margin создаёт расстояние до прилегающих блоков.

Свойство box-sizing меняет расчёт размеров. Параметр content-box считает только наполнение. Параметр border-box вмещает padding и border в суммарную размер.

Параметр display устанавливает тип представления. Блочные блоки захватывают всю свободную ширину. Инлайновые элементы располагаются в одной строке. Значение inline-block сочетает свойства обоих типов.

Параметр position регулирует позиционированием. Вариант relative сдвигает компонент относительно первоначального места. Absolute располагает блок относительно родительского элемента. Новейший Вулкан казино применяет Flexbox и Grid для построения сложных структур.

Отзывчивая разработка для разнообразных устройств

Адаптивная верстка обеспечивает корректное отображение сайта на всех экранах. Посетители заходят на веб-страницы с десктопов, планшетов и мобильных устройств. Дизайн должен подстраиваться под размер монитора автоматически.

Медиазапросы используют стили в связи от свойств аппарата. Инструкция @media контролирует ширину дисплея и иные свойства. Специалисты создают отдельные коллекции стилей для разных промежутков габаритов.

Метод mobile-first открывает проектирование с версии для телефонов. Начальные стили определяют оформление для маленьких дисплеев. Медиазапросы добавляют усложнения для крупных дисплеев.

Адаптивные сетки применяют пропорциональные единицы измерения. Ширина элементов устанавливается в процентах вместо статичных пикселей. Flexbox и Grid создают гибкие структуры без комплексных расчётов.

Картинки нуждаются повышенного подхода при оптимизации. Параметр max-width со значением 100% блокирует вылет картинок за края блока. Свойство srcset скачивает изображения разнообразного разрешения. Грамотная реализация казино Вулкан улучшает пользовательский восприятие на всех категориях платформ.

Распространённые промахи стартующих при работе с HTML и CSS

Новички разработчики допускают стандартные недочёты при разработке страниц. Понимание распространённых проблем способствует исключить их в своих работах. Исправление промахов на начальных фазах сберегает время и усиливает уровень скрипта.

Основные ошибки при работе с разметкой и стилями:

Проблемы с CSS также наблюдаются постоянно. Стартующие пропускают прописывать меры измерения для числовых параметров. Чрезмерно специфичные селекторы затрудняют корректировку стилей. Отсутствие обнуления стилей браузера порождает отличия в отображении на разных устройствах.

Игнорирование кроссбраузерной согласованности ведёт к проблемам. Веб-страница может прекрасно выглядеть в одном обозревателе и некорректно в другом. Проверка программы через специализированные сервисы обнаруживает синтаксические недочёты. Систематическая верификация способствует Вулкан обеспечивать превосходное качество программирования и соответствие стандартам.

Geef een reactie

Je e-mailadres wordt niet gepubliceerd. Vereiste velden zijn gemarkeerd met *